How does the consolidation of stock affect the value of digital currencies?

In the world of digital currencies, how does the consolidation of stock impact their value? Can changes in the stock market have a direct influence on the prices of cryptocurrencies? What are the factors that contribute to this relationship between stock consolidation and digital currency value?

- The consolidation of stock can indeed affect the value of digital currencies. When there is a consolidation in the stock market, it often leads to a decrease in investor confidence, which can result in a shift of funds from riskier assets like cryptocurrencies to more stable options. This can cause a decline in the demand for digital currencies, leading to a decrease in their value. Additionally, if the consolidation is driven by negative economic factors, it can create an overall bearish sentiment in the market, impacting the prices of all assets, including digital currencies.

- Stock consolidation can have both positive and negative effects on the value of digital currencies. On one hand, if the consolidation is driven by positive economic factors and leads to increased investor confidence, it can attract more capital into the market, including investments in digital currencies. This increased demand can drive up the prices of cryptocurrencies. On the other hand, if the consolidation is driven by negative economic factors, it can create a risk-averse environment where investors prefer traditional assets over digital currencies, leading to a decrease in their value.
